What aspects could you have in synastry to make the other person think they own you .

for example a guy im seeing has Venus and mars in cancer in his 2nd house and he is VERY protective . He doesn't like to hear me talk about other guys in a good way . I told him a story about an encounter i had with a few guys (when i wasn't with him) and he wouldn't let me finish because it made him feel like smashing his head up against a wall lol.

The funny thing is im a Taurus , and so is his sister and so was his last girlfriend and he is REALLY protective over them . like crazy protective . like all of us are born in late April . In his case his 12th house rules his 2nd house . (his 12th house is taurus)

I just want know is it the synastry aspects or the persons own placements that make them this way .

From me interpreting his protectiveness i would say its because his Venus and mars can make him quick to anger especially over issues concerned with the second house .

Like is this because of his own chart or could there be synastry aspects that would make someone become pore posessive or protective .

for example me and him have
Mars trine venus double whammy
venus sextile venus double whammy
mars sextile mars double whammy
Moon conjunct Neptune
Venus square Saturn
Mars square saturn

In the relationships where I had Moon/Pluto, Mars/Pluto and Venus/Pluto - I felt like there was no question about the intensity level between us... and neither of us were that jealous or possessive - since it was so obvious that we were so strongly into each other.

Even in one situation, where we had Venus opp Pluto & Mars opp Pluto -- and we never ended up dating - I still felt like the emotions between us were very obvious and clear.. I never felt like I had reason to mistrust that.. so it wouldn't have bothered me to see him make out with 10 other women right in front of me - since I was so beyond clear on the fact that it would never be 'the same' with those women..... (unless of course they also had Pluto aspects with him! loll)

In the relationship - with Libra guy (above^) - we had Moon conjunct Moon in Cap, My Mars/Neptune conj his AC... our AC/DC axis was reversed. We had a lot of conjunctions and trines but not much Pluto happening.
If anything - it was the fact that on some level he *knew* I was never his... that made him jealous.
Because as much as I cared about him as a friend.. I was never 'in love' as such - even when we were together.

With all those Pluto aspects you guys mentioned - it was just obvious that we were in love - so insecurity was thrown out the window for the most part.
This was even more so the case - when the aspects were very close. With the only man I feel like I was 'in love' with - my Pluto is conjunct his Mars in Scorpio (0' orb) - and my Moon - Cap is trine his Pluto - Virgo (also 0' orb). I was and still am so sure of him.. I can't even explain how sure. I can still say I trust him 100% years later.
:edit: In natal, I have Venus opp Pluto - and he has Venus conj Pluto.
